Paint Update!

So as you know, the project is called XMS GT-R, and for all of you I hope you were following AzNkEvIn's original. Kevin drew out these graffiti XMS letters and they've inspired me to remake the car after i picked it up from him, so naturally I have to preserve the letters. How to do that? well simple, tracing paper, markets, a bright screen and index car makes a stencil... here you are, the car was primer, painted black, wet sanded, re-coated black to cover up imperfections, masked and as it sits now, 2 Coats of pearl white.


----------------------------------------------------------------------

















The pearl white after two coats (light powder then cover coat, 3rd coat was applied as a wet coat, still needs a couple more coats)
